Output 86b66dbeb8d12ac94fb3b28de9065d1bc4300e7a392379756a57a79eb59c547c:0

value
34770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f483f5529d340ef6b047af8e86116fc1bea2da OP_EQUAL
address
35EzX4kSwKZug4gg4coF99kWtxR8Q7Nzph
transaction
86b66dbeb8d12ac94fb3b28de9065d1bc4300e7a392379756a57a79eb59c547c